I entered data in Sheet1. Afterwards I entered data in Sheet2. Some of the data unexpectively appeared also in Sheet1 even though it was written in Sheet2. Some data in Sheet1 was overwritten with data from Sheet2 without viewing Sheet1 or getting any warning. The result was that I became very scared of using the application. It seemed like the problem started when copying and pasting data and formulas within Sheet2, but I am not sure.
This does normally not happen. But there exist a feature to achieve this behavior. If you have both sheets selected, then entering something will effect both sheets. You can select (and unselect) more than one sheet if you shift-click on the tab. Please make sure, that you have selected only one sheet when you see the error.
But I think there should be a warning, that cells are not empty, for direct entering too, as it is when you paste something into the cells. Defect or enhancement?
